Ecumenical Vespers for Northeast Florida

Participate in the universal Week of Prayer for Christian Unity! Ecumenical Vespers for Northeast Florida will be held on Monday, January 29, 2018 at 6:00 PM at the Riverside Presbyterian Church, 849 Park Street, Jacksonville, FL 32204.

The Biblical theme for 2018 as agreed between the World Council of Churches and the Pontifical Council for Promoting Christian Unity will be "Your right hand, O Lord, glorious in power" (Exodus 15:6).
